The AI-generated tag refers specifically to images/videos that are fully generated by an artificial intelligence program or model (such as Stable Diffusion), with no human input other than prompting. AI-assisted works, which have been significantly edited or retouched by a human, are technically allowed, but may have trouble getting through the modqueue.

"Computer-generated" can refer to 3D images/videos, which are allowed. Stuff drawn on a tablet is still considered "drawn" and, of course, allowed.

It's best to read the wiki pages, particularly help:upload rules, and the pages it links to, for more details on what is and isn't allowed.
